This induction cooktop stands out with its focus on efficiency and safety. Unlike traditional electric burners that heat up slowly and retain heat for a long time, the ChangBERT uses electromagnetic energy to directly heat the cookware. This results in faster heating times and more precise temperature control. The robust stainless steel construction and NSF certification also suggest a product built to withstand heavy use, a key consideration for anyone looking beyond occasional cooking.

Power & Efficiency

The power and efficiency of a countertop burner dictate how quickly and effectively it heats up and cooks your food. You’ll want to look at the wattage – higher wattage generally means faster heating. For example, the dual hot plate model with a combined wattage of 1500W is noticeably faster at boiling water and searing meat than the 1000W single burner model. Also, consider whether you need independent temperature controls if you plan to cook multiple dishes simultaneously, as some models offer this added convenience. The 1500W dual hot plate really shines here, allowing you to simmer sauce on one burner while searing protein on the other.

Temperature Control

Precise temperature control is vital for achieving consistent cooking results. Look for burners with adjustable temperature knobs that offer a range of settings, typically from LOW to HIGH. This allows you to maintain a simmer, keep food warm, or bring liquids to a rapid boil. Some models may have more granular temperature settings, offering greater control. It’s worth testing the accuracy of the temperature settings – some burners might run hotter or cooler than indicated. All of the models I tested claimed similar control ranges, but I found the dual 1500W burner was most reliable at holding a consistent simmer.

Ease of Cleaning

Let’s face it: nobody enjoys cleaning up after cooking. Opt for a countertop burner with a non-stick cooking surface, like the cast iron flat cooking plates found in most of these models. These surfaces are designed to be easily wiped clean with a damp cloth or non-abrasive sponge. Avoid using harsh chemicals or scouring pads, as these can damage the non-stick coating. The models with removable drip trays offer an extra layer of convenience, making cleanup even easier. In my experience, a quick wipe-down after each use keeps these burners looking and performing their best.

Portability & Size

Countertop burners are often chosen for their portability, making them ideal for small kitchens, dorm rooms, camping trips, or even office use. Consider the size and weight of the burner if you plan to transport it frequently. Compact and lightweight models are easier to pack and carry. While all models claim to be portable, the models with a more robust frame may be more suited for heavy duty, outdoors use. If you prioritize portability above all else, a smaller, single-burner option might be the best choice.

Safety Features

Safety should always be a top priority when selecting a countertop burner. Look for features such as power indicator lights, which clearly indicate when the burner is turned on. This helps prevent accidental burns. Also, non-skid feet are essential for keeping the burner stable during use, minimizing the risk of spills. Some models may also include automatic shut-off features to prevent overheating. All the models I tested include these safety measures, but it’s always wise to double-check before making a purchase.

Durability & Build Quality

A durable countertop burner will withstand frequent use and last for years to come. Look for models made with high-quality materials such as cast iron or stainless steel. These materials are resistant to rust and corrosion and can withstand high temperatures. Check for sturdy construction and well-secured components. While aesthetics are subjective, a well-built burner will often look and feel more substantial.

Do I need an induction burner in my kitchen?

An induction cooktop like the ChangBERT offers noticeable performance benefits, mainly faster heating and more precise temperature control. If you’re a serious home cook who values efficiency and precision, it’s a worthy investment. However, induction cooktops require compatible cookware, which can be an additional expense. If you’re primarily looking for a basic burner for occasional use, the Elite Gourmet models provide a more affordable alternative without sacrificing essential features. Think about your cooking style and budget before committing to induction.
